How much do step van j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 7, 2026, the average hourly pay for step van in the United States is $15.13,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$12.50 and $17.07 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Step Van position,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Step Van Driver, you need a valid commercial driver’s license (CDL) or appropriate state-issued driver’s license, a clean driving record, and physical stamina for loading and unloading cargo. Familiarity with GPS navigation systems, handheld scanners, and fleet management software is often required to efficiently complete delivery routes. Excellent time management, communication skills, and a customer-service mindset help drivers resolve issues and build rapport with clients. These skills ensure timely, accurate deliveries and positive customer experiences in a fast-paced logistics environment.

What does a typical day look like for a Step Van Driver?

A typical day for a Step Van Driver involves inspecting the vehicle before departure, mapping delivery routes, and loading cargo for multiple stops. Throughout the day, you'll use route optimization tools and delivery scanners to track packages and complete drop-offs, often interacting with customers at homes or businesses. Step Van Drivers are usually part of a larger logistics team, collaborating with dispatchers and warehouse staff to resolve challenges quickly. The role can require flexibility to adapt to traffic, weather, or unexpected delivery issues, making each day dynamic and rewarding.

What is a Step Van job?

A Step Van job typically involves driving a step van to deliver packages, goods, or services. Step van drivers often work for courier companies, food distributors, or service providers, transporting items to businesses or residences. Responsibilities include loading and unloading cargo, following delivery routes, and ensuring timely deliveries. Some positions may also require handling paperwork or interacting with customers. This job requires a valid driver's license and, in some cases, a commercial driver's license (CDL).

Job description

Independent Fedex Ground Contractor looking for delivery drivers who have experience with trucks/step vans (CDL not required). If you have 1 year verifiable commercial driving experience in the past 3 years of a like size vehicle - a box truck (at least 14ft), straight truck or step van - we offer a full time position. Drivers load and unload packages in a fast-paced team environment and ensure that packages are delivered on time and with care. Work is 5 days a week, 7am till finished. Must pass final road test in order to get approved.
Requirements and Abilities:
-Must be 21 or older to apply
-Must have valid driver's license
-Eligible to work in the US
-Have 1 year verifiable commercial driving experience in the past 3 years of a like size vehicle - a box truck (at least 14ft), straight truck or step van!
-Physically fit (being able to lift at least 70lb)
-Able to pass Medical Exam, Drug Test
-No DWI,
-No suspensions or revocations of license,
-No reckless or aggressive driving (no more that 15mph above speed limit or no driving above 80mph),
-No more than 2 moving violations in 12 months,
-No operating a vehicle while texting, emailing, or cell phone (No cellphone tickets within past 3 years),
-No more than 2 accidents.
-Ability to understand and follow instruction regarding work duties and safety methods.
-Ability to comprehend numbers and information in order to sort and deliver packages correctly.
-Ability to scan packages, read labels and charts, and memorizing routes.
-Ability to use basic tools and equipment such as hand trucks, dollies, hand-held scanners.
-Strong communication and interpersonal skills; ability to work well in a fast-paced team environment.
-Performs other duties as assigned.
